STELVIO FOR TT100
On the 18-01-18, one of my best friends was sadly taken when his Fishing Vessel, the “Nancy Glen” (TT100) capsized in a tragic accident just off the coast of my local village, “Tarbert” Loch Fyne. My lifelong friend, Duncan MacDougall (TT) and his fellow crew member Przemek Krawczyk are believed to be within the Vessel which heartbreakingly remains on the sea bed. Fortunately a third member of the Crew survived and is recovering from his ordeal. There has been an extremely successful campaign set up to raise funds to bring our boys home and I would like to support this campaign when I participate in the Granfondo Stelvio Santini, with all proceeds going to this particularly worthy cause and to support both Wives and their young families during this unbearably traumatic time and beyond.
Granfondo Stelvio Santini takes place on 03-06-18 where I will attempt to set off from Bormio in Italy and complete the long Route of 151km with approximately 4058 metres /13314 feet of ascent (Ben Nevis x3), incorporating the brutal 17km Mortirolo Pass (1726m) which is considered one of the toughest and most challenging climbs in Europe and finishing atop the notorious 22km Passo Stelvio, the highest road pass in Italy at 2758m. As a keen cyclist, I will train 6 days a week over the next 4 months in order to do the crew of the Nancy Glen justice and raise further much needed funds.
